Next day, Sebastian noted visible change in Raabia. She is all smiles and glowing. Smiles? And Raabia? It is a miracle.

Another miracle is Raabia wearing a dress. Dressed in lacy taffy pink knee-length summer dress and with her unruly curls open she looked like a girl, a very beautiful girl. Sebastian rubbed his eyes to ensure that he saw her wearing heels, for reals. Indeed, she is wearing heels. He is shocked.

The long unbuttoned white blazer over her off-shoulder dress is the only hint that will tell someone that she is Raabia.

'Hey.' She greeted Sebastian happily. He continued to gape at her. Raabia smiled flipping her hair with attitude.

She recollected Saad's awed expression on seeing her in this avatar. That was her aim. To make Saad weak in his knees. He had complimented and not only that, he had also taken her in his arms and kissed her passionately. Bonus for Raabia.

She had only read and seen in cheesy novels and movies how love transforms people and make them do silly things. She had found that utterly idiotic. Now, she realized that love indeed changes people. It is a beautiful feeling.

But she is also glad that she didn't fall in love earlier, falling in love with Saad is million times more beautiful.

Not only Sebastian but everyone else in the office noticed changes in Raabia. She ignored the envious glances of the women and gazes of men. Raabia isn't used to all this but she managed it well.

'Kya baath hai, Maam, you are glowing.' Ajmal complimented Raabia with a smile. He had come to hand over a file to her. She looked up from her computer screen and he bit his tongue. He feared she will scold him.

Instead, Raabia smiled. 'You are glowing yourself. Janet?' She winked at him making him blush. He nodded shyly and lamely excused himself. Raabia smiled shaking her head.

For the first time in her career, Raabia felt restless and excited to go home. She wanted to be with Saad, spend as much as time as possible. Every time she thought of it she blushed.

'Kya Yaar, Saad! All smiles. Lost your virginity, Kya?'

Saad's smile turned into a deadly glare.

'Shut up, Omar.' He said shifting in his seat. His other two of his friends chuckled. Saad ignored them and fished out his lunch box. This is the first time, Raabia has taken the care to pack him lunch.

'OOOO.' His friends hooted. Saad blushed.

He brought the box to his nose and sniffed the Aloo Matar Sabzi (Potato and peas) and smiled. He fell in love with her cooking all over again.

Everyone except Omar tasted the food and complimented Saad. He smiled with pride. Omar glared at him. He loathes Raabia, he hasn't yet forgiven her for the slap. Then, that night his friend spoke angrily to him on phone. Omar holds Raabia at fault for it. He clenched his fists tightly and continued to glare at him.

'Omar, yaar. Have it.' Saad said forwarding the lunch box towards him. Omar masked his anger and politely refused.

Later that night after dinner Saad and Raabia sat together on the bed, a safe distance between them. Raabia felt shy meeting his gaze while Saad was propped up on his elbow and kept staring lovingly at her.

'Guess, what Raabia.' He extended his hand and held Raabia's hand, she stopped drawing circles on the bed and looked up at him. He patted the back of her palms and continued, - 'Everyone loved the food, but-'

Raabia felt her heartbeat increase, she spoke her fear, - 'And you?' She looked anticipatorily at him. Saad smiled but Raabia is still holding her breath.

'Of course, I always love the food you make.' He complimented and Raabia is relieved. She let out the breath she had been holding and forced a smile.

Saad sighed and shifted little. As his arm brushed against hers, Raabia felt goosebumps. Her heart began to flutter.

'I think it is burdening for you to wake up early and prepare lunch. Then get ready for work yourself.'- He looked sincerely at her, - 'Don't worry about me, I will manage.' He said.

Raabia shifted closer and placed her palm over their overlapping palm.

'I am not making lunch for you because I should. I am doing it because I want to.'

Saad felt touched, he smiled at her.

'I love you, Saad.' She confessed. Saad sat up and held her face. He kissed her forehead and whispered, - 'I love you too.' His lips lingered on her forehead for some time before he moved his lips and captured her lips in a passionate kiss.
